Trafficking in human beings in Southeastern Europe. UNICEF, UNOHCHR, OSCE-ODIHR (2002)
In 2001/2002, within the framework of the
Stability Pact Trafficking Task Force, the United Nations
Children's Fund (UNICEF), the UN Office
of the High Commissioner for Human Rights (UNOHCHR) and the OSCE Office
for Democratic Institutions and Human Rights (OSCE/ODIHR) commissioned
this joint report. The report presents the situation of and responses
to trafficking in human beings in these countries:
Albania
Bosnia and Herzegovina
Bulgaria
Croatia
the former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ia
Serbia and Montenegro
the UN Administrated Province of Kosovo
Moldova
Romania

In 2002/2003 UNICEF, UNOHCHR and OSCE/ODIHR continue their co-operation aimed at monitoring the implementation of the National Plans of Action to Combat Trafficking and developing regional policy and program guidelines based on human rights.
